Our latest release in the series of the music of Sir Donald Francis is of his piano trio, Op.27 performed by the London Piano Trio, the sonata Eroica for solo violin, Op.29 played by soloist Robert Atchison, and the enchanting piano quartet, Op.12 with the Ormesby Ensemble. Sir Donald Francis Tovey, born on the 17th of July 1875, was a British musical analyst, musicologist, writer on music, composer and pianist. He is best known for his Essays in Musical Analysis, some of which were broadcast on the BBC. He was a highly respected concert pianist and played piano with the Joachim Quartet in a 1905 performance of Johannes Brahms’ Piano Quintet.
